Ferrari and Antonelli battling back on home soil and Alonso with a point to prove – What To Watch For in the Emilia-Romagna GP


From an all-important run to Tamburello to Fernando Alonso at the sharp end again, and from home favourites facing tough afternoons to crucial pit stop timing, here are a five things to keep your eye on when the lights go out on race day at Imola…
1. A crucial start
The opening seconds of any race are important, but in Imola they are even more so when the race is dry because overtaking can be so difficult around this iconic circuit.
